Melissa, Kate, and Leah recap the Supreme Court's recent opinions about the Internet and intellectual property. As we predicted, the Internet isn't going to end with a bang-- and not even a whimper. Plus, we give you the "highlights" of the oral arguments in the Texas mifepristone case... which are even wilder (and more terrifying) than we could have imagined.Sign up to see the Strict Scrutiny live show in Washington, DC on June 9th!The hosts covered the arguments of the opinions for Gonzales v.
